Duties Help Position Description #
T5718P01 POSITION DUTIES
This position is loced in the Command Section, Communicions unit, Mission Support Group of an Air Nional Guard Flying Wing. The primary purpose of this position is to serve as a senior informion technology (IT) and communicions specialist and consultant to management in support of installion IT and communicions policy and plans to include the unit's ability to provide command, control, communicion, computer, and intelligence (C4I) programs essential to the operions, training, and readiness missions. Analyzes organizional processes and procedures through assessment of management, operional, technical and administrive practices pertinent to the organizion. Identifies process, system, and training deficiencies by applying defect prevention principles and root cause problem resolution techniques and recommends corrective action for each. Duties involve a wide range of IT and communicions management activities th extend and apply to the entire organizion. Serves as an advisor to the Commander and senior staff members regarding compliance, readiness posturing, and mission limiting issues.
MAJOR DUTIES
1. Performs studies and independently establish plans for improving the efficiency of informion technology and communicions processes. Performs studies of all aspects of the installion's informion technology and communicions programs, processes, and methods. Evalues existing systems and capabilities and inities feasibility studies to determine ways and means necessary to enhance mission performance. From those studies, derive cost benefits and /or required investment and recommends a best course of action along with proposed alternives. 2. Interprets a variety of technical requirements making independent judgments to determine organizional compliance with applicable instructions, procedures and practices. Audits IT programs, processes and projects. Continually assesses policy needs and interprets broad DoD, AF, and other higher headquarters guidance and applies it through development of policies for the area of responsibility. 3. Evalues mission effectiveness, using standardized and locally developed evaluion programs and processes. Manages the scheduling and accomplishment of managerial, personnel, technical and special evaluions. Collectively evalues management effectiveness, performance and technical proficiency of assigned personnel, equipment, and systems condition. Coordines and/or conducts management studies of organizion, staffing, work measurement, methods, or procedures. 4. Advises supervisors and managers on the evaluion of programs, policies, regulory requirements, and procedures. Recommends the establishment of quantity or quality criterion. Develops baseline for use in measuring and analyzing organizional productivity and effectiveness. Develops process, management, administrive and technical evaluion plans for implemention. Notes deficiencies, identifies necessary resources, and recommends corrective actions. 5. Coordines with HHQ elements, Program Management Offices, Specific System/Hardware Support Elements, OEM Vendors and Vendor Contracted support facilities for issue resolution. Research includes using various means and media to obtain needed informion to accomplish the task. May require the use of various stand alone (e.g., paper based, CD, DVD, etc.) or on-line (network or web based) methodologies to obtain needed informion. 6. Develops, implements and maintains work center training programs. Plans and schedules tasks and training activities for drill stus guard members. Oversees and conducts on-the-job training (OJT) for personnel. Crees and develops lesson plans. Ensures availability of facilities and training aids. Monitors the training stus of personnel and ensures th supplemental and/or remedial training is accomplished. Responsible for documention of accomplished training in a timely manner. May require the use of a directed automed training documention system. Adheres to management control plan requirements by conducting self inspection and staff assistance s. Resolves identified discrepancies. 7. Performs other duties as assigned. Requirements Help Conditions of employment Federal employment suitability as determined by a background investigion. GENERAL EXPERIENCE
: Experience th provided a basic knowledge of da processing functions and general management principles th enabled the applicant to understand the stages required to autome a work process. Experience may have been gained in work such as computer operor or assistant, computer sales representive, program analyst, or other positions th required the use or adaption of computer programs and systems.
SPECIALIZED EXPERIENCE
Experience th demonstred accomplishment of computer project assignments th required a range of knowledge of computer requirements and techniques. For example, assignments would show, on the basis of general design criteria provided, experience in developing modificions to parts of a system th required significant revisions in the logic or techniques used in the original development. Accomplishments, in addition to those noted for the GS-9 level, normally involve the following, or the equivalent: Knowledge of the customary approaches, techniques, and requirements approprie to an assigned computer applicions area or computer specialty area in an organizion; Planning the sequence of actions necessary to accomplish the assignment where this entailed coordinion with others outside the organizional unit and development of project controls. Adaption of guidelines or precedents to the needs of the assignment. Technical knowledge of communicions infrastructure, including the ability to read and interpret blueprints, alongside a general understanding of acquisition and contracting processes such as Stements of Work (SOWs) and Performance Work Stements (PWS). Educion Major study--computer science, informion science, informion systems management, mhemics, stistics, operions research, or engineering, or course work th required the development or adaption of computer programs and systems and provided knowledge equivalent to a major in the computer field.
